Skip to content

DOC-3221: Refine language and structure in CONTRIBUTING.md for clarity and consistency. #3735

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Open
wants to merge 1 commit into
base: release/8.0.0
Choose a base branch
from

Conversation

kemister85
Copy link
Contributor

Ticket: DOC-3221

Changes:

  • All references to TinyMCE are accurate and reflect the current product version and supported tools (e.g., Antora, AsciiDoc).
  • All personal and second-person pronouns (e.g., “we,” “you,” “our,” “your,” “I”) are removed or reworded to meet Tiny style standards.
  • Language is consistent with the TinyMCE documentation style guide: Formal tone, Active voice, uses en-US spelling and avoids contractions, slang, jargon, and metaphors.
  • Markdown or HTML syntax for links, code blocks, and live demos is updated and correctly formatted using AsciiDoc conventions.
  • Section structure is clear and consistent, using appropriate heading levels.

Pre-checks:

  • Branch prefixed with feature/<version>/, hotfix/<version>/, staging/<version>/, or release/<version>/.
  • Visual check for correct document render.

Review:

  • Documentation Team Lead has reviewed

@kemister85 kemister85 added this to the TinyMCE 8.0.0 milestone May 20, 2025
@kemister85 kemister85 requested review from spocke, TheSpyder, a team, jscasca, ltrouton and MitchC1999 and removed request for a team May 20, 2025 11:46
@kemister85 kemister85 requested review from abhinavgandham, soritaheng and a team as code owners May 20, 2025 11:46
@kemister85 kemister85 added the upcoming release Documentation for features currently under development/QA label May 20, 2025
@kemister85 kemister85 requested review from EkimChau and Skylite73 May 20, 2025 11:46
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
upcoming release Documentation for features currently under development/QA
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ant